How to get from Balwyn to Norong by bus and train?

By bus and train

To get from Balwyn to Norong in Melbourne, you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one bus line: take the LILYDALE train from East Camberwell station to Southern Cross station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the ALBURY - MELBOURNE VIA SEYMOUR train and finally take the WANGARATTA - YARRAWONGA VIA PEECHELBA, KILLAWARRA bus from King George Gardens/Rowan St (Wangaratta) station to Hallens Rd/Murray Valley Hwy (Norong)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 5 hr 7 min. The ride fare is A$22.38.
